Management of Patients with Positive Sentinel Lymph Node After Neoadjuvant Chemotherapy
Presenter: Judy C. Boughey, MD

LEARNING OBJECTIVES
Upon completion of this activity, participants should be able to: 

1. Explain the risk of additional positive nodes in the setting of a positive SLN after neoadjuvant chemotherapy
2. Explain axillary management strategies in the setting of a positive SLN after neoadjuvant chemotherapy
